What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an executive assistant, and why are they important?

To excel as an Executive Assistant, you need exceptional organizational skills, attention to detail, and proficiency in office administration, typically supported by a relevant degree or experience. Familiarity with scheduling software, Microsoft Office Suite, and communication tools like Zoom or Slack is crucial. Outstanding interpersonal skills, discretion, and adaptability help build trust and manage high-pressure situations effectively. These abilities are vital for ensuring seamless executive support, efficient operations, and maintaining confidentiality in fast-paced business environments.

What are some common challenges faced by executive assistants when supporting multiple executives, and how can these be managed effectively?

Executive Assistants often support more than one executive, which can create challenges such as managing conflicting priorities, coordinating multiple calendars, and handling a high volume of communications. To manage these effectively, strong organizational skills, proactive communication, and the ability to anticipate executives' needs are essential. Many successful Executive Assistants rely on digital tools for scheduling and task management, set clear expectations with each executive, and practice regular check-ins to stay aligned with shifting priorities.

Responsibilities:

  • Provide friendly, knowledgeable, and efficient service in a fast-paced, high-standards environment

  • Develop specials that highlight seasonal ingredients and offer guests unique, exciting options beyond the seasonally changing menu

  • Contribute ideas and development support for seasonal menu planning

  • Work efficiently during service while maintaining food quality and consistency

  • Recruit, onboard, train, schedule, and supervise back-of-house staff

  • Develop Chefs and back-of-house team members

  • Support the Manager in daily kitchen operations and service execution

  • Lead, motivate, and train the kitchen staff, fostering a collaborative and high-performance team culture

  • Ensure all kitchen staff adhere to food safety standards, cleanliness, and proper cooking techniques

  • Manage kitchen operations during service, ensuring timely and quality food delivery

  • Cook on the line or Expo as needed while maintaining quality, consistency, and timing

  • Maintain the highest standards of food quality and presentation

  • Monitor food preparation to ensure consistency in flavor, texture, and portion control

  • Perform regular quality checks on ingredients, preparation, and final dishes

  • Ensure recipes, portioning, and presentation standards are followed

  • Monitor food safety, sanitation, and cleanliness throughout the kitchen

  • Control food costs by managing inventory, minimizing waste, and optimizing ingredient usage

  • Manage labor, food waste, and overall kitchen efficiency

  • Work closely with leadership to improve systems and guest experience

  • Step in to resolve issues during service and support smooth operations

  • Communicate effectively with the kitchen team, servers, bartenders, support staff, and managers to ensure smooth service flow

  • Follow proper food handling, storage, and labeling procedures

  • Maintain cleanliness and organization of station, equipment, and work areas

  • Use kitchen equipment safely and properly

  • Assist with prep, cleaning, and kitchen side work as needed

  • Support menu rollouts, seasonal changes, and staff education in collaboration with Management Team

  • Adhere to all food safety, sanitation, and health department regulations

  • Uphold Harvests brand, service standards, hospitality culture and policies

  • Assist with opening and closing duties and other side work

  • Perform additional duties as needed to support kitchen and restaurant operations
